Looking for Divorce Lawyers in St. Cloud?

Divorce lawyers specialize in the legal dissolution of a marriage. They guide clients through the complexities of dividing assets and debts, determining spousal support (alimony), and resolving disputes through negotiation, mediation, or litigation when necessary. These attorneys advocate for their clients’ financial interests to achieve a fair and equitable settlement or court order.

How do I request my entire file including engagement agreement, all correspondence between the two divorce attorneys and file?

Sign a substitution of attorney making you your own attorney until you find a new one. Call your attorney tell him you want him to sign a substitution and ask for your file. Give him a few days or a week to have it ready for you.

Is there anything I can do without a lawyer if my ex recently stopped paying spousal support?

If there is an order requiring him to pay child support, then you can make a motion for him to be held in contempt. You can do it on your own, but it would be easier with an attorney. Also, if it is clear that the child support is owing, then your attorney can probably recover his or her attorney fees from your ex.

Can my husband get money after I won a medical lawsuit if he divorces me?

Depends on how the settlement was structured/ written up. Check with an attorney who has reviewed the document. Controlling case is probably Florida Supreme Court decision in Weisfeld.
